John Spencer Huntington: Germany West Mission, August 26, 1972 - August 26, 1974

My mission was originally organized as the West German Mission 01 January 1938. The name was changed to Germany West Mission on the 10th of June, 1970 and again only four years later, to the Germany Frankfurt Mission on the 20th of June, 1974, just two months before I left. I served my mission during the "cold war", prior to the fall of the Berlin wall, and at that time there were four missions in West Germany: the Germany North (Hamburg), Germany Central (Düsseldorf), Germany West (Frankfurt) and Germany South (Munich). Additionally, there were separate missions in both Switzerland and Austria. The landscape of the church's organization in that part of the world has of course altered substantially in the intervening years, as it has across the globe.
